Henry leaned back in his chair, rolling his shoulders with a sigh as he glanced at the clock. Almost done for the day. He had just a few more reports to check before he could head home. The work wasn’t particularly thrilling today, but there was a quiet satisfaction in knowing he was contributing to something bigger than himself. The last few weeks had been a whirlwind, but he was finally settling into a rhythm, training administrator by day, doting mate by night. Just as he was about to stand and stretch, his phone buzzed on the desk. He picked it up and saw the caller ID. Kaius.
